Red Hair Dye on Dark Hair: How Long Does It Take? Factors & Tips

It's impossible to give a definitive answer to how long it takes to dye dark hair red without more information. Here's why:

* Starting hair color: The darker your natural hair color, the longer it will take to achieve a vibrant red, and the more challenging it can be.

* Desired shade of red: A deep burgundy red might be easier to achieve on dark hair than a bright, fiery red.

* Hair condition: If your hair is damaged or porous, the dye may take longer to penetrate and deposit color.

* Type of dye: Permanent dyes will generally require a longer processing time than semi-permanent or temporary dyes.

* Professional vs. home dyeing: A professional stylist has the expertise and tools to lighten hair effectively and achieve a desired red shade. Home dyeing can be trickier and require more time and effort.

Here's what you can expect:

* Lightening dark hair: This is often a multi-step process involving bleach and can take several hours, especially if you want a bright red.

* Red dye application: Once your hair is lightened, the red dye will need to be applied and processed according to the instructions on the dye box.

Important notes:

* Professional help is recommended: For significant color changes, especially from dark to light, it's highly recommended to consult a professional hair stylist to avoid damaging your hair.

* Patch test: Always do a patch test on a small section of hair before applying any new dye to your whole head. This can help you determine if you have any allergic reactions.

* Patience is key: Achieving the desired red shade on dark hair may take time and effort, so be patient and follow the instructions carefully.
